Arturs Mons
Of Course is undeniably a gorgeous restaurant—every design detail has been thoughtfully curated, creating a visually stunning and immersive space. The vibe leans toward upscale speakeasy, with dim lighting, cozy seating, and a great music selection that makes it feel both refined and relaxed. Service was top-notch. Attentive, friendly staff made us feel genuinely welcome, and the cocktails were fantastic—well-balanced, creative, and beautifully presented. The food is good, no doubt about it. But the “shareable” concept might be a bit misleading—don’t expect anything close to family-style portions. The plates are quite small, and while some dishes are worth the splurge, others feel a bit overpriced for the quantity you receive. All in all, I had a good time and appreciate the experience. That said, with it being a 30-minute drive from downtown, I don’t see myself going out of the way to return. The food, while enjoyable, wasn’t quite compelling enough to make the trip feel necessary.
